
It's an excuse for not owning the .com domain name.
I was reading an article in The Economist about companies trying to appeal to conservative Americans. One of the companies mentioned is RedBalloon, a job site that helps people find jobs at right-leaning companies.
The company uses RedBalloon .work, and the article includes this parenthetical:
(The company's founder bought the domain RedBalloon.work because .com "sounded too much like communist".)
Well, that's a new selling point for choosing something other than .com domain names!
I'm going to guess that the founder went with the .work domain name because the .com domain was taken. RedBalloon.com was registered in 1997 and is used by a balloon store in Seattle.
